The final, held in Lisbon, Portugal, was a unique event, showcasing a tournament format altered by the COVID-19 pandemic. The traditional two-legged ties were scrapped from the quarter-finals onwards, replaced by a series of single-leg knockout matches. This change injected an extra dose of excitement, with every game carrying immense weight and the potential for upsets.     Before we go any further, let's not forget the pandemic, which dramatically changed the tournament's format. The traditional home-and-away knockout ties were replaced with a one-off match, meaning every game was a final. The format change also meant games were played behind closed doors, lacking the atmosphere we're used to. It's safe to say it was one of the most unpredictable Champions League seasons in history.
